Japan Indirect Fired Air Heater Market Insights Application of Japan Indirect Fired Air Heater Market The Japan indirect fired air heater market finds extensive application across various industries, including manufacturing, food processing, chemical production, and textile industries. These heaters are essential for providing clean, heated air without direct contact with combustion gases, ensuring safety and air quality standards. They are widely used in facilities requiring precise temperature control and high efficiency, such as in drying processes, space heating, and pre-heating applications. The equipment’s ability to operate efficiently in harsh environments and its compliance with strict environmental regulations make it a preferred choice for industrial applications in Japan. Additionally, their versatility allows integration into existing systems, enhancing operational productivity and energy savings. Download Sample Ask For Discount Japan Indirect Fired Air Heater Market By Type Segment Analysis The Japan indirect fired air heater market is segmented primarily based on the type of heating technology employed, with categories including direct-fired, indirect-fired, and hybrid systems. Indirect-fired air heaters operate by heating air through a heat exchanger, ensuring that combustion gases do not come into contact with the air being heated, which is particularly advantageous in applications requiring clean or uncontaminated air. Among these, indirect-fired systems are increasingly favored in industries such as pharmaceuticals, food processing, and electronics manufacturing, where air purity standards are stringent. The market size for indirect-fired air heaters in Japan was estimated at approximately USD 150 million in 2023, representing a significant share of the overall air heater market, which is valued at around USD 300 million. The CAGR for this segment is projected at roughly 4.5% over the next five years, driven by rising industrial automation and stringent environmental regulations. Japan Indirect Fired Air Heater Market By Application Segment Analysis The application landscape for indirect fired air heaters in Japan spans several key sectors, including food processing, pharmaceuticals, electronics manufacturing, and chemical industries. These applications are classified based on their specific heating requirements, such as process heating, space heating, and sterilization. The market size for indirect-fired air heaters in the food processing sector was approximately USD 60 million in 2023, reflecting its dominant position due to the high standards for hygiene and contamination control. The pharmaceutical industry follows closely, with an estimated market share of USD 50 million, driven by the need for sterile, contaminant-free environments. Electronics manufacturing and chemical processing sectors are also significant, collectively accounting for around USD 40 million. The overall application market is projected to grow at a CAGR of about 4.8% over the next five years, fueled by increasing industrial automation, stricter safety standards, and a shift toward energy-efficient heating solutions.
